Whether the Swans were genuinely interested or whether it was a media/agent link we will never know but yesterday’s reports suggest that Liverpool are not prepared to sanction a loan move for Calvin Ramsay this window. Having secured his services in a £6.5m move from Aberdeen back in the summer it...
